About DCET 2023

The full form of DCET is Diploma Common Entrance Test. Karnataka Examination Authority conducts the DCET every year. Qualifying candidates are shortlisted for 2nd-year undergraduate Engineering and 1st-year Architecture programs. The candidates who qualify for the exam will be eligible for admission to both day and evening colleges in Karnataka.

DCET 2023 Eligibility Criteria

Karnataka Education Authority sets the Karnataka DCET 2023 eligibility criteria. Candidates need to know about the eligibility criteria before applying for the exam. Below is the information regarding eligibility for various courses.

DCET 2023 Eligibility Criteria for BE Courses (Day/Evening Engineering Colleges)

The candidates must have passed the diploma from a recognized university with 45% marks. For SC/ST/OBC candidates, the minimum passing mark is 40%.

The candidates must also have full-time work experience for 2 years from a recognized government or private firm/company/industry

DCET 2023 Eligibility Criteria for B.Arch Courses (Day Engineering College)

The candidates should have secured at least 40% in NATA 2023 conducted by the Council of Architecture. All applicants must have qualified for the final diploma exam (or equivalent) with at least 50% aggregate marks combined. Candidates belonging to SC/ST/OBC, native to Karnataka, require 45% marks.

DCET 2023 Exam Pattern

Candidates must prepare an effective study schedule, and to do that, they must have a good understanding of the DCET 2023 exam pattern. Provided below are the important details of the DCET 2023 exam pattern.

DCET 2023 Exam Pattern
Particulars Details
Exam Mode Offline - OMR-Based Test
Type of Questions Objective - Multiple Choice Questions (MCQs)
Number of Questions 100
Exam Duration 180 Minutes (3 Hours)
Total Marks 100
Marking Scheme 1 Mark Awarded for Correct Answer
Negative Marking No Negative Marking

DCET 2023 Subject-Wise Marks Distribution

DCET 2023 exam will be conducted from 10:00 AM to 1:00 PM for all candidates, and a Kannada Language test will be conducted from 3:00 PM to 4:00 PM, on the same exam date, for Horanadu and Gadigadu Kannadiga candidates in Bangalore. The total marks for the Kannada test will be 50. Check the table below for the subject-wise marks distribution for DCET 2023 below.

DCET 2023 Subject-Wise Marks Distribution
Subject
Marks
Applied Science
50
Applied Mathematics
50
Total Marks (All Programs)
100

DCET 2023 Syllabus

The conducting authority released the detailed DCET 2023 syllabus for Applied Mathematics and Applied Science on the official website. Candidates can refer to the table below for the topics included in the syllabus for all programs.

DCET 2023 Syllabus
Subject Topics
Applied Mathematics Matrices & Determinants
Vectors
Probability
Allied Angles & Compound Angles
Complex Numbers
Limits
Straight Lines
Differentiation
Applications of Differentiation
Integral Calculus
Definite Calculus
Differential Equations
Applied Science Mechanics
Properties of Solids & Liquids
Heat & Properties of Gases
Wave Motion
Modern Physics
Industrial Chemistry
